Project Overview: Bechtel is building a semiconductor manufacturing plant in New Albany, Ohio. We are partnering with the North America Building Trades Unions and suppliers to create several thousand new jobs and work with local education organizations to implement new training programs that will support the future talent pipeline. Bechtel Manufacturing & Technology, Inc. offers engineering, procurement, and construction services for customers in the semiconductor manufacturing, electric vehicle, and data center markets. Headquartered in Reston, Virginia, the M&T global business unit also includes colleagues working in Arizona, Ohio, Texas, India, and additional project locations around the world. Job Summary: The Lead People Based Quality Engineer (PBQE) will report to the Project Quality Manager (PQM) and will be responsible for leading the People Based Quality (PBQ) program. The PBQE will support the PQM to develop and deliver a customized PBQ program, including a risk-based strategy that meets project goals and objectives, including alignment, prioritizing, scheduling, training, metrics/dashboards, and tracking progress of PBQ improvement initiatives. The PBQE will apply leadership skills, knowledge, experience, and tools (e.g. PBQ, behavioral and facilitation techniques) to close gaps and invest in opportunities, resulting in institutionalized changes that measurably improve efficiency, productivity, and quality across the project. The PBQE will be responsible for using data to measure and report project performance, and ensure improvements are institutionalized. The PBQE will lead teams through the PBQ process to solve problems and make fact-based decisions to deliver ‘Right the First Time’ quality; and facilitate resolution of issues, improvements, and opportunities across all functions and project teams.
